General Description
The MAXQ618 is a low-power, 16-bit MAXQ
®
microcon-
troller designed for low-power applications including uni-
versal remote controls, consumer electronics, and white
goods. The device combines a powerful 16-bit RISC
microcontroller and integrated peripherals including two
universal synchronous/asynchronous receiver-transmit-
ters (USARTs) and an SPI master/slave communications
port, along with an IR module with carrier frequency
generation and flexible port I/O capable of multiplexed
keypad control.
The device includes 80KB of flash memory and 2KB of data
SRAM. The MAXQ61C is a ROM version of this device.
For the ultimate in low-power battery-operated perfor-
mance, the device includes an ultra-low-power stop mode
(0.2µA typ). In this mode, the minimum amount of circuitry
is powered. Wake-up sources include external interrupts,
the power-fail interrupt, and a timer interrupt. The micro-
controller runs from a wide 1.70V to 3.6V operating voltage.
